Gianni Stecchi
Gianni Stecchi (born 3 March 1958) is a retired Italian pole vaulter.

Biography
He won one medal at the International athletics competitions.[1] He is the father of Claudio Stecchi.
Achievements
| Year | Tournament | Venue | Result | Extra |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1987 | World Indoor Championships | Indianapolis, United States | 10th | |
| European Indoor Championships | Liévin, France | 11th | ||
| World Championships | Rome, Italy | 11th | ||
| Mediterranean Games[2] | Latakia, Syria | 1st |
National titles
He has won 3 times the individual national championship.[3][4]
- 2 wins in pole vault (1986, 1987)
- 1 win in pole vault indoor (1987)
